When you install Google Chrome on your computer or mobile device, it automatically imports personal data like browsing history and homepage. However, no additional information can also be added, such as bookmarks, search engines, saved passwords and settings.
If you want to discover how to import this configuration to your browser, follow these simple steps:
-
Before you begin, close all browsers you have open.
-
Open Google Chrome.
-
Click on the menu on the browser toolbar.
-
Select Bookmarks.
-
Click Import Bookmarks and Settings.
-
In the dialog box "Import Bookmarks and Settings" link, select the application that includes the options that you want to import.
-
Click Import.
If you already have files stored on your Chrome, this process will generate another folder to avoid replacing them.
